Glacier Overview

The Perito Moreno Glacier, a breathtaking natural wonder in Patagonia, offers visitors a mesmerizing glimpse into the icy world of glaciers. Towering ice formations create a stunning landscape, showcasing the raw power of nature.

The glacier’s slow yet relentless glacial movements add to its allure, with the ice constantly shifting and reshaping the terrain. Visitors can witness the glacier in action, experiencing the thunderous sounds of ice cracking and calving into the turquoise waters below.

The Perito Moreno Glacier serves as a living testament to the Earth’s ever-changing environment, inviting guests to marvel at the beauty and grandeur of one of the world’s most spectacular ice formations.

Weather Considerations

When planning a visit to the Perito Moreno Glacier, considering the weather conditions is crucial for ensuring a safe and enjoyable experience. The glacier region experiences climate variations, so visitors should be prepared for sudden changes in weather. It’s advisable to check weather forecasts before the trip and pack accordingly.

Weather precautions are necessary, as conditions can be unpredictable, with strong winds and sudden temperature drops. Dressing in layers, including waterproof and windproof clothing, is recommended to stay comfortable. Plus, wearing sturdy footwear with good traction is essential for navigating potentially icy paths.
